The Shift from Diesel to Electric
Traditional mining trucks are massive consumers of diesel, contributing significantly to greenhouse gas emissions, operating costs, and noise pollution. Electric drive mining trucks, powered by Lithium-Ion Batteries, Hydrogen Fuel Cells, or other electric drive systems, offer a compelling alternative. They produce zero tailpipe emissions, reduce energy costs, and provide a quieter, more comfortable working environment for operators.
The Surface Mining application is currently the largest segment, where large electric haul trucks are replacing diesel fleets in open-pit operations. However, Underground Mining is the fastest-growing segment, as electric trucks offer significant advantages in confined spaces, including improved air quality and reduced heat generation. The Lithium-Ion Battery is the dominant power source, but Hydrogen Fuel Cells are the fastest-growing, offering extended range and fast refueling.
Key Drivers of Market Growth
The electric drive mining truck market is propelled by several powerful drivers. Government incentives and support are a primary factor, with many countries offering tax breaks, grants, and subsidies for electric vehicle adoption in the mining sector. Rising fuel prices and operational costs are making electric trucks an increasingly attractive economic proposition, with potential for up to 30% reduction in operational costs over the lifespan of the vehicle.
Growing focus on safety and worker health is another critical driver. Electric trucks reduce exposure to diesel particulates, noise, and heat, improving the working environment. Increased demand for sustainable mining solutions is a major driver, as mining companies seek to reduce their carbon footprints and meet ESG (Environmental, Social, and Governance) targets. Technological innovations in battery technology, electric drivetrains, and automation are enhancing performance and reliability.
